Feed
Feed is when a hero dies frequently, giving the enemy an advantage by granting them extra gold and experience. The term applies both to accidental deaths caused by mistakes and to intentional actions. From this word also comes the insulting nickname "feeder", used to describe a player who dies often and thus helps the enemy team.
